Beep card payments are now accepted at GHL operated terminals. Usually, Beep cards are used in the LRT and MRT for commuting. The collaboration looks to help the Beep cards get accepted across all terminals operated by GHL. Suffice it to say, Beep cards are looking to expand their services. For a limited time, beep Card users can now earn more reward points which can be exchanged for load, QR transport tickets, and other special promos via the beep mobile app. AF Payments Inc., the consortium behind the beep cashless payment, has introduced new reward points system: • Every PHP 1 spent using beep card = 1 point • 200 points = PHP 10 beep Card transactions include payments on uses, PUVs, convenience stores, select retail and food establishments, and railway transits, namely LRT1, LRT2, and MRT3.
